Malaysia Carbon Nanotubes Market Overview

Market Valuation Growth :

Malaysia's carbon nanotubes market is valued at USD 15.8 million in 2026 and is projected to grow to USD 31.9 million by 2031, representing a robust 15.12% CAGR over the forecast period.

Regional Manufacturing Hub :

Malaysia's strategic position as Asia Pacific's advanced materials and electronics manufacturing hub is driving significant adoption of carbon nanotubes in semiconductor and electronics applications.

Semiconductor Demand Driver :

The semiconductor industry in Malaysia is a primary growth catalyst, with increasing demand for carbon nanotubes in chip manufacturing, interconnects, and thermal management applications.

Outpacing Global Growth :

Malaysia's market CAGR of 15.12% exceeds the global carbon nanotubes market CAGR of 14.88%, indicating accelerated regional adoption and investment in nanotechnology infrastructure.

              Market Definition

              According to the American Carbon Society, carbon nanotubes are cylindrical nanostructures composed of rolled graphene sheets with exceptional mechanical strength, electrical conductivity, and thermal performance. Carbon nanotubes refer to advanced nanomaterials used to enhance conductivity, durability, and lightweight properties in applications such as electronics, energy storage, automotive components, aerospace materials, and conductive polymers. Their multifunctional performance and compatibility with high-performance material systems are driving increasing adoption across advanced manufacturing industries.
